First of all, what was your introduction into MMA? How did you get started?
When I was ten, I started training in judo and I mixed it with football. When I turned 13, I switched to Thai boxing and my MMA career began with that.

What's your memory of when you first stepped into an MMA gym?
I remember that I was very clumsy. I lost a lot in the gym, but I always had an aspiration.

Can you talk about where you're from and where and why did you move?
I'm from the small town of Kizilyurt, it is located in the Republic of Dagestan, about thirty thousand people live there. By the way, Khabib is also from there. I moved to the US because here, the top of MMA is the UFC and some of the strongest fighters in the world gather here, I want to become the best and compete at a high level.

What team do you train with and who are some of your main sparring partners?
I train with the Kill Cliff team, I consider it as one of the best *gyms) in the world. There are so many monsters training with a high level of skills. Here each sparring partner is strong in their aspect.

You had an extensive amateur career. What was the reasoning behind taking so many fights? What made you decide to go pro when you did? What was your biggest takeaway from your amateur career?
The reason that I have a great amateur career is because I was burning with it.  I wanted to become the best. I understood that this (amateur) career would prepare me for a pro career.  That I would have experience and experience very important and it would help me a lot in my pro career. I wanted to go pro at 18, but my older brother wouldn’t let me. I think it was the right thing to do and I turned pro when I turned 21, then I felt stronger for the pros.

What are your accomplishments in all combat sports?
Winning the World Combat Sambo Championship and winning the Russian MMA Championship. I think if I start listing all my achievements now, it will take up a lot of space. Let's just say that I participated in such disciplines as Sambo, MMA, hand-to-hand combat, Thai boxing, kickboxing, judo, Wushu Sanda, Kung Fu, grappling, BJJ, karate, football, rugby, I performed everywhere wherever possible.

You kinda of went viral for your training footage with Ilia Topuria was released. How do you think it went and is it true you got the best of him?
You know, it‘s just sparring, there are different feelings in combat and sparring. We had three tight rounds and we didn‘t give in to eachother and the last round turned out to be bloody, Topuria is in his rightful place.

Did you have any inspirations when you got in the sport?
When I was four, I watched Pride for the first time, and I liked it and I was excited about it. I was always interested in fighting in the ring and in a big arena with a lot of people in the arena.

For anyone who's never seen you fight what would you tell them to expect?
Watch and support me now because my time will come when I will dominate the lightweight division. A new star will soon appear in this weight class

What is your goal? Is it the UFC or are you open to ONE, Bellator, and PFL?
My goal is UFC gold because it’s like the Olympic Games in judo.

Why do you fight and who do you fight for?
I fight because it gives me pleasure when you are standing in the ring and there is another guy across from you and we find out who is stronger These feelings cannot be described in any way.
